JOB SUMMARY, DESCRIPTION & QUALIFICATIONS:

Job Summary

This is a front-facing position requiring a professional presence representing the VP and direct reports. Provides direct executive-level support to the VP, Human Resources, Facilities & Risk Management and related areas , to ensure efficient and compliant operations to meet the needs of the department. Coordinates and processes high-level, confidential information to ensure internal and external responsibilities are met for the College departments reporting to the VP. Primary duties include providing Board and Executive Leadership Team (ELT) presentations/submissions, creating draft correspondence, memos and policies, coordinating activities for VP and HRM, serving as point of contact for VP and the HR, Facilities, and Risk Management teams, coordinating timely completion of goals/objectives, metrics, Board and ELT requirements and compliance requirements, researching and drafting for legal cases, investigations and compliance, document preparation, schedule/calendar management, budget management, purchasing, customer service, and organizing travel arrangements.

Essential Functions and Responsibilities

The following duties are primarily performed and are essential for this position. Employees are expected to be able to perform each of these job duties satisfactorily and successfully with or without reasonable accommodation.

Administrative Support:

  • Provide a high level of proactive, detailed, highly confidential executive administrative support to the VP, Human Resources, Facilities & Risk Management, and the direct reports of that position with its department needs.

  • Works closely with and backs up President's and ELT's executive staff to ensure high level of support is provided to meet needs.

  • Monitor the VP's email/calendar including organizing, tracking, and appropriate follow-up, directing to the proper parties, and/or proactively responding on behalf of the VP.

  • Exercise good judgment in anticipation of the VP's needs, make decisions within the scope of authority, and discreetly handle/resolve difficult situations and confidential matters.

  • Research, prepare recommendations, answer questions, provide information and assistance, direct customers to appropriate areas, and respond professionally to concerns.

  • Utilize available resources (AI, internet) to conduct in-depth research and perform critical analysis in preparation of drafts and recommendations to VP for Collegewide communications, templates, position papers, legal cases, policies, procedures and budget.

  • Organize, handle, retrieve, and file confidential and sensitive material.

  • Monitor annual department project list to ensure deadlines are met including strict regulatory timelines for legal, compliance, investigations, certifications, etc.

  • Manage special projects, create College org charts and department-specific spreadsheets, compile and measure metrics, research and analyze relevant information, etc.

  • Ensure the VP and direct reports are prepared and have all applicable documents and necessary resources for upcoming compliance requirements, meetings, events, travel, etc.

Customer Service:

  • Proactively research and prepare appropriate first-level responses and beyond for incoming queries, emails, and communications.

  • Provide backup and collaboration with all other administrative staff supporting ELT members.

  • Participate in and support Collegewide functions, including organizing, planning and implementation of events.

Schedule/Calendar Management:

  • Maintain and monitor appointment calendar, scheduling, and travel arrangements.

  • Anticipate and resolve scheduling conflicts and ensure proper time management and schedule prioritization of VP's meetings.

  • Assist with the planning and coordinating of special committee meetings, team retreats, training days, etc. Takes minutes and prepares future meeting action plans.

  • Read minutes and identify action items and organize resolution.

  • Assist VP and direct reports with meeting coordination to ensure department representation.

Budgeting/Finance:

  • Work with NTC's budget system to perform data entry functions, monitor budgets, write and process budget transfers, prepare travel reimbursements, payment authorizations, requisition,supplies and materials, etc. Track data and report trends and make recommendation to respond to data.

  • Approve invoices and verify correct budget strings are being charged.

  • Manage expense reporting, including receipts and preparation and submittal for final approval. Support direct reports with budgetary needs as well.

  • Create the generation of ongoing weekly budget reports, data entry input of open POs and Operational POs as requested, assist with the monitoring of operational budgets and creating transfers or journal entries for balancing, and prepare travel reimbursements and payment authorizations.
